The mission of the University City Area Council is to promote economic development and business interests in the University City area. Read More
The geographical regional boundaries for UCAC include I-77, N. Tryon St., Eastfield Rd. – US 115 and parts of Harris Blvd. View Map

REAL ESTATE CONFERENCE & TOWN CORRIDOR OVERVIEW
The University City Area Council's 4th Annual Real Estate Conference will be held on 4/14/2005 at Hilton Charlotte University Place. Last year's panelists included the following area planners: Jeff Young of Concord, Jonathan Marshall of Cabarrus/Harrisburg, Debra Campbell of Charlotte-Mecklenburg and Jack Simoneau of Huntersville. UCAC RACE TASTE
University City Area Council's annual Race Taste event includes live entertainment, great food from area restaurants, children's activities, pace car rides, and more. Proceeds to benefit financial assistance programs for children at the University City YMCA. More Info
